The literary character who died the most in film and television dramas - Yuwen Chengdu

author:Ginkaze Society

Although Yuwen Chengdu is not a historical figure, because of the deep influence of various novels and commentaries such as Tang Dynasty, Yuwen Chengdu also frequently appears in Sui and Tang film and television dramas, becoming a literary figure with the most dead methods.

First, let's take a look at the death method of Yuwen Chengdu in each edition of the novel, although they were all killed by Li Yuanba, but they are different.

First of all, "Speaking of Tang", Yuwen Chengdu was torn in half by Li Yuanba's several moves:

Yuwen Chengdu... Stiffening his scalp, urging the horse to lift a gold hammer to hit the Yuanba. Before li yuanba arrived, he beat Chengdu's hammer aside, pounced on it, and pulled Chengdu Lejiaqian aside... Mention the horse, throw it into the air, and fall down. Yuanba caught up with it and tore his feet apart and split into two pieces.

Then there is "The Legend of Xing Tang", which performs slightly better, and is smashed to death by Li Yuanba's double hammer:

Yuwen Chengdu's big cross of seven wind wings and golden hammers was shot down on the top of Li Yuanba's head. Li Yuanba held up a double hammer, slightly wrapped the stirrups, avoided the tip of the stirrup and a stirrup wing, and used his right hand to single hammer a cover and put it on top of a stirrup wing. How much strength he put on the shelf, he threw himself into his arms, and as soon as he crossed his body, he listened to a whimper, and Yuwen Chengdu's wind wing was gone. Li Yuanba took the hammer and shook it, and Yuwen Chengdu bowed his head. The two horses charged through the stirrups, and Li Yuanba's double hammer fell down together. burst! Yuwen Chengdu spilled blood on the battlefield, and people died and collapsed.

Finally, there is Tian Lianfang's commentary, in which Yuwen Chengdu and Li Yuanba are not much different, it can be said that between Bo Zhong, in the defeated army and to be distracted from protecting Yu Wenhua, he was killed after sixty years of battle with Li Yuanba.

Li Yuanba is a fresh force, Zi Wencheng is a defeated general, and he protects his father, afraid of Yu culture and losses, so he cannot be handy. After more than sixty rounds of fighting, Gilded Andi was shocked by Li Yuanba's double hammer, Yuwen Chengdu was about to run, and Li Yuanba caught up with a hammer and hit him on the back, broke his bones, and died under the horse.

After talking about the novel and the commentary, I looked at the various ways of death of Yuwen Chengdu in the film and television drama.

2012 Yongle version of "Sui and Tang Dynasty": With the battle of Sanduo for dozens of times, Chengdu trembled and stomped Sanduo under his feet, and then Sanduo stormed out and tore it in half.
